The Real Q4 Problem

Increased activity does not automatically mean increased opportunity for your business.

A rushed response to the wrong solicitation can consume time, money and subcontractor resources without producing a credible submission.

The federal fourth quarter can create additional buying activity, shortened timelines and pressure to move quickly. That pressure causes many small businesses to chase opportunities without confirming fit, pricing feasibility, compliance requirements or performance capacity.

Registration in SAM.gov is only the beginning. A business still needs a practical opportunity strategy, accurate solicitation analysis, confirmed resources and a disciplined submission process.
